My P1S has been working fine for a year, then just stopped in the middle of a print with a blockage in the extruder unit, which I cleared, but this did not fix the issue. I have replaced the extruder unit, extruder motor and hot end, and it still fails to load the filament.
When I try to load the filament (PLA), it will start to pull it in and after a couple of seconds will make a repeated clicking noise, which I think may be the filament skipping. The filament never makes it to the nozzle, but there can’t be a blockage, as everything is new.
The filament is far enough in that I can’t pull it out, I have to go through the unload process, so it is being pull in, but just getting stuck somewhere.
